Addressing concerns with automatic sprinkler usually starts with identifying clogged nozzles, an usual issue that can significantly impact watering effectiveness. Blocked nozzles can arise from collected debris such as dust, sand, and raw material. Identifying this problem early is critical for preserving a healthy yard.Irregular or weak water circulation often indicates a blockage. Inspect the nozzles aesthetically for any kind of noticeable particles. Rinse the nozzles under running water to ensure all particles is removed.
Reinstall the cleansed nozzles and check the sprinkler system again. Maintaining the nozzles clean makes sure optimal water circulation, promoting a rich and healthy and balanced yard.
Repairing Low Tide Pressure
Reduced water pressure in sprinkler systems can often prevent effective watering, leading to under-watered locations and stressed out plants. Common offenders consist of a partly shut primary water shutoff, leakages in the watering system, or a defective pressure regulator.
Another potential cause is the dimension and design of the watering pipelines. Pipes that are as well slim or exceedingly long may limit the flow of water. Upgrading to a larger diameter pipe or reconfiguring the format to shorten the range water trips can boost stress.
Take into consideration the total water need of the system. Surprise watering times to make certain each area gets adequate pressure for optimal irrigation. By methodically attending to these factors, you can bring back correct water stress and maintain a healthy garden.
Fixing Broken Lawn Sprinkler Heads
Dealing with broken sprinkler heads can typically seem overwhelming, but understanding the procedure can streamline the task dramatically. Identifying the issue is the initial step; common signs consist of irregular water spray patterns, swamping around the lawn sprinkler, or a completely non-functional head. When determined, the next step includes turning off the water supply to prevent more damage.Very carefully dig around the sprinkler head without harming the bordering turf. Remove the damaged head by loosening it from the riser, guaranteeing no particles drops right into the system.
Select a matching brand-new sprinkler head and screw it onto the riser securely. Prior to backfilling the opening, transform the water back on to evaluate the new head for correct procedure. Guarantee it turns properly and covers the designated location evenly. When validated, load the hole and rub down the soil to bring back the yard.
Readjusting Timer Settings
Correctly readjusting your lawn sprinkler's timer settings is important for keeping an effective irrigation timetable and preserving water. A well-calibrated timer makes sure that your garden receives the specific amount of water it requires, reducing waste and stopping overwatering. Start by checking out the climate and particular sprinkling demands of your plants. Different plants have differing water requirements, and seasonal modifications frequently necessitate changes to the timer setups.Begin by accessing the control board of your lawn sprinkler system. A lot of contemporary timers enable customization in terms of days, begin times, and duration. Establish the timer to water throughout the early morning or late night to reduce evaporation, hence maximizing water efficiency (sprinkler repair). Ensure that each area receives sufficient water by setting proper run times based upon the kind of plants and soil composition in each location.
On a regular basis testimonial and readjust the timer settings to reflect modifications in weather or plant development phases. Rain sensors or weather-based controllers can better maximize water use by changing the schedule instantly in response to weather. Careful management of timer setups not only promotes a lush, healthy and balanced garden but likewise contributes to lasting water use techniques.
Attending To Shutoff Problems
While maximizing timer setups plays a critical function in maintaining an efficient lawn sprinkler system, attending to shutoff issues is equally crucial for ensuring correct water distribution. Lawn sprinkler shutoffs control the circulation of water to various zones within your garden. Malfunctioning valves can cause irregular watering, triggering some locations to be overwatered while others remain completely dry.Typical shutoff concerns consist of particles buildup, electric malfunctions, and worn-out diaphragms. Debris can clog the valve, limiting water circulation. To solve this, initially, shut off the supply of water and disassemble the valve. Get rid of any type of debris and wash the elements prior to reassembling. If the trouble persists, examine the diaphragm for damage; replacing a harmed diaphragm can recover typical feature.
Electrical concerns usually occur from malfunctioning solenoids, which are accountable for opening and shutting the shutoffs. Test the solenoid by utilizing a multimeter to inspect for continuity. sprinkler repair. If the solenoid is defective, changing it ought to settle the problem
Routine upkeep and timely fixings of lawn sprinkler shutoffs not only enhance the system's efficiency yet also add to the general wellness of your garden.
